On Wed, Sep 18, 2002 at 03:22:05PM -0400, Jason Tishler wrote: > Any suggestions on how to best fix this build problem will be greatly > appreciated? It appears that I can workaround the problem by executing: $ aclocal $ autoconf before doing the normal GNU build procedure: $ configure $ make $ make install My WAG is that fetchmail's aclocal.m4 is built against a version of gettext that has a bug in the "GNU gettext in libintl" check. Can anyone confirm or refute this hypothesis?
